private List <SubjectResults> fetchSubjectsResultTitle(SqlCommand cmd) { SqlConnection con = cmd.Connection; List <SubjectResults> subjectresults = null; con.Open(); using (con) { SqlDataReader dr = cmd.ExecuteReader(); if (dr.HasRows) { subjectresults = new List <SubjectResults>(); while (dr.Read()) { SubjectResults sr = new SubjectResults(); sr.Id = Convert.ToString(dr["id"]); sr.Sub_r_id = Convert.ToString(dr["sub_r_id"]); sr.Student_id = Convert.ToString(dr["student_id"]); sr.Subject_name = new SubjectsDAL().SelectById(Convert.ToInt32(dr["subject_id"])); sr.Total_marks = new ResultsDAL().SelectSubjectTotalMarksWithIds(Convert.ToInt32(dr["subject_id"]), Convert.ToInt32(dr["sub_r_id"])); sr.Obtn_marks = Convert.ToDouble(dr["obtain_marks"]); sr.Status = Convert.ToInt32(dr["status"]); subjectresults.Add(sr); } subjectresults.TrimExcess(); } } return(subjectresults); }
public ActionResult UpdtSubjectsResult(List <SubjectResult> Add) { if (Session["Username"] == null && Session["Password"] == null) { return(RedirectToAction("Index", "Admin", new { area = "" })); } else { if (ModelState.IsValid) { List <SubjectResults> subjectsresult = new List <SubjectResults>(); foreach (SubjectResult gdfc in Add) { SubjectResults dbr = new SubjectResults(); dbr.Obtn_marks = gdfc.Obtn_marks; dbr.Id = gdfc.Id; dbr.Status = gdfc.Status; subjectsresult.Add(dbr); } new Cateloge().UpdtSubjectsObtnMarks(subjectsresult); TempData["Msg"] = "Subjects Result Have Updated Successfully"; return(RedirectToAction("View", new { id = Add[0].Student_id })); } return(RedirectToAction("Index")); } }
public ActionResult AddSubjectResult(List <SubjectResult> Add) { if (Session["Username"] == null && Session["Password"] == null) { return(RedirectToAction("Index", "Admin", new { area = "" })); } else { if (ModelState.IsValid) { List <SubjectResults> subjectsresult = new List <SubjectResults>(); foreach (SubjectResult gdfc in Add) { SubjectResults dbr = new SubjectResults(); dbr.Obtn_marks = gdfc.Obtn_marks; dbr.Sub_r_id = gdfc.Sub_r_id; dbr.Student_id = gdfc.Student_id; dbr.Status = gdfc.Status; dbr.Subject_id = gdfc.Subject_id; dbr.Date = DateTime.Today.ToString("dd-MM-yyyy"); dbr.Month = DateTime.Today.ToString("MMM"); dbr.Year = DateTime.Today.ToString("yyyy"); dbr.Time = DateTime.Now.ToString("HH:mm:ss"); subjectsresult.Add(dbr); } new Cateloge().AddSubjectsObtnMarks(subjectsresult); TempData["Msg"] = "New Subjects Result Have Added Successfully"; return(RedirectToAction("View", new { id = Add[0].Student_id })); } return(RedirectToAction("Index")); } }
private List <SubjectResults> fetchResultTitle(SqlCommand cmd) { SqlConnection con = cmd.Connection; List <SubjectResults> subjectresults = null; con.Open(); using (con) { SqlDataReader dr = cmd.ExecuteReader(); if (dr.HasRows) { subjectresults = new List <SubjectResults>(); while (dr.Read()) { SubjectResults sr = new SubjectResults(); sr.Sub_r_id = Convert.ToString(dr["sub_r_id"]); sr.Subresult = SelectResultTitleById(Convert.ToInt32(dr["sub_r_id"])); subjectresults.Add(sr); } subjectresults.TrimExcess(); } } return(subjectresults); }